skills/notebooklm/SKILL.mdNotebookLM - Expert Knowledge to Action
Turn any expert's content into a personalized protocol with experiments you actually run. Load 300 YouTube episodes into NotebookLM from terminal, run a cited interview about your goal, create experiments in your Obsidian daily note.
Video walkthrough: https://youtu.be/KRpZSvtMiTI
What This Does
- Load sources from terminal. You can't just tell NotebookLM to add a YouTube channel. This skill does it. One command. 300 episodes.
- Cited answers traced to exact transcript lines. Every recommendation links back to the exact episode and passage. Verifiable.
- Expert-informed interviews. Claude queries NotebookLM with YOUR goal. Generates questions informed by the expert's research on your specific topic.
- Experiments in Obsidian. Protocol becomes experiments in your daily note. Morning routine skill asks every day: how is this going?
- Any expert, any domain. Huberman for health. Lenny for product. Onboarding docs for a new job. Same pattern.

Citation Resolution
The resolver turns
[N] markers in NotebookLM answers into clickable [[Source#^c-XXXXXXXX|[N]]] wikilinks. Click to jump to the exact cited passage in the source transcript.
- Anchor IDs are stable (MD5 of cited text)
- Idempotent: re-running same question skips existing anchors
- Cross-source citation remap: handles collapsed source_ids
- ~96% resolution rate across tested queries
